The Legacy Hall of Fame Game designer, Sid Meier, has been called "The Father of Computer Gaming" with such early hits as F-15 Stealth Fighter, Railroad Tycoon, and Pirates. He put computer gaming on the map however, in 1991, when he delivered Sid Meier's Civilization® to the gaming world launching the "God Game" genre and creating one of the most award winning and addicting games on the planet. Civilization remains one of the world's top selling PC game series with over 8 million units sold and is recognized by the press as one of the greatest game franchises ever created. |

Customer Review: Three Words: Simpler, Shorter and Just as Fun.
I have always love Civilization games. They are interesting, challenging and enjoyable. If you are reading this review, then you maybe wonder how this console compare to the PC version. I have played over 20 games on this version, so I have certainly passed the initial phrase. Civilization Revolution is a more streamlined version and not as deep as the PC version. For example, there is no peasant unit. Roads are no longer built by peasants one square at a time; instead, you simply pay for the cost of the road and it will be constructed instantaneously. It is certainly a much simpler game (I really miss the fact that I can no longer destroy enemy's roads). The upside is that the game is much shorter and therefore you can finish one game in 3 hours, not 3 days or 3 weeks. I really like this. If I am still a college student on summer vacation, then I may not appreciate this "short" feature as much. However, for many of us who has a full time job, this is just great. I cannot tell you how many games I start giving up because I don't have the time to invest in them. This is a simpler game, but not necessary an easier game. I played Civilization III and I was winning 80% of the Emperor level games and losing 90% of the Deity games. In revolution, I am currently winning 80% of the Emperor games and losing all of my Deity games. The graphic and music of this game is just great. However, there are a few things I wish the game has kept. For instance, there are "unique" units, but they are only different in appearance and not as much on stats. This is one feature which I count as a pure "dumb-down" change. Taking the peasant units out has a up side and a down side. It makes the game simpler and faster. Taking unique units out, simply make the game simpler. I only see a down side in this change.
